Turning clamp for bearing cover of main speed reducer of automobile rear axle
Technical Field
The utility model relates to an automobile parts machining technical field especially relates to an automobile rear axle main reducer bearing cap turning anchor clamps.
Background
The automobile rear axle main reducer assembly is a key part assembly on a heavy automobile, and mainly has the main function of reducing the rotating speed transmitted from a main transmission shaft so as to increase the torque and change the power direction, and is used as a main reducer shell of an important part on the main reducer to play a role of fixedly supporting each part on the main reducer, a bearing gear inner hole which plays a role of positioning a gear and an input shaft is arranged in the main reducer shell, the mounting precision of a bearing cover and the main reducer shell directly influences the transmission precision of the main reducer, in the processing process, the outer circular surface of the bearing cover needs to be turned so as to meet the design precision and the mounting precision with the main reducer shell, the processing of a numerical control processing center needs higher investment, the common lathe is generally used for processing, and as the bearing cover is irregular in shape, the clamping difficulty is higher, only one piece can be processed at a time, and the repeated clamping labor intensity is high, the working efficiency is low, and the production requirement can not be met.

Drawings
F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is a schematic bottom view of FIG. 1;
FIG. 3 is a top view of FIG. 2;
fig. 4 is a schematic view of the assembly of the pin and the connecting disc in a preferred embodiment.
In the figure: the processing device comprises a rotating shaft 1, a connecting disc 2, a pin shaft 20, a trapezoidal boss 200, a trapezoidal groove 21, a set screw 22, a pressing assembly 3, a double-thread screw 30, a nut 31, a pressing plate 32, a bearing cover 4 and an outer circular surface 40 to be processed.

The turning clamp for the bearing cover of the main speed reducer of the rear axle of the automobile as claimed in claim 1, wherein: the compressing assembly comprises a double-threaded screw, one end of the double-threaded screw is in threaded connection with the rotating shaft, the other end of the double-threaded screw extends out of the connecting disc and stretches out of an end threaded connection nut, a pressing plate capable of moving up and down is sleeved at the middle of the double-threaded screw, and the pressing plate is matched with the nut to enable the pressing plate to compress the bearing cover.
3. The turning clamp for the bearing cover of the main speed reducer of the rear axle of the automobile as claimed in claim 2, wherein: the pressing plate is of a cross structure, and four ends of the cross pressing plate are respectively used for pressing one bearing cover.
4. The turning clamp for the bearing cover of the main speed reducer of the rear axle of the automobile as claimed in claim 1, wherein: the pin shaft is in threaded connection with the connecting disc.
5. The turning clamp for the bearing cover of the main speed reducer of the rear axle of the automobile as claimed in claim 1, wherein: the pin shaft is connected with the connecting disc through a pin hole.
6. The turning clamp for the bearing cover of the main speed reducer of the rear axle of the automobile as claimed in claim 1, wherein: four groups of radial trapezoidal grooves are formed in the connecting disc, trapezoidal bosses matched with the trapezoidal grooves are arranged at the connecting ends of the pin shafts and the connecting disc so that the pin shafts can slide in the trapezoidal grooves, and set screws for fixing the pin shafts in the trapezoidal grooves are further arranged.
